A onesie designed to give the illusion that the baby wearing it has a curvy woman’s body covered by a red polka dotted bikini is sparking outrage among some parents. , reports WMC-TV in Southhaven, Miss.
The onesie, manufactured by Bon Bebe, is sold at the department store Gordmans in Southaven, WMC-TV reported. Gordman's didn't immediately return a call by TODAY.com requesting comment.
